A showing of the acclaimed BBC film of Owen Sheers’ work inspired by the 70th anniversary of the NHS. Owen will be reading sections of his Faber long poem of the same name and answering questions from the audience.
“It’s been a privilege to be able to engage via interviews and poetry with the idea and the people of the NHS for this project, and to be part of a film hoping to give voice to the ethos, philosophy and experience of the service”
– Owen Sheers
Moderated by renowned Palliative Care specialist Baroness Ilora Finlay.
